
Not limited to Transfermarkt, experts from the CIES Football Observatory also evaluate football players. Euro-football.ru reported on this.
According to the International Centre for Sports Studies, the most expensive player in the Russian Premier League is not a foreign player, but Russian footballer Aleksey Batrakov from the Lokomotiv team. His "fair value" is estimated to be around 38-44 million euros.
In second place is Luis Enrique from the Zenit team, with a value of 32-37 million euros. Third place is held by Matvey Kislyak from CSKA, whose value is estimated between 28-33 million euros.
Additionally, Aleksey Batrakov has scored six goals after four rounds in the Russian Premier League, leading the top scorers. This information reflects the players' values and their performance effectiveness in the current season.
